I called Yank about the PT4400. It is ideal for NA. It can handle the juice, but it will flash high and the shift extensions are even higher so unless you plan to rev it to high hell on the jug you are better off NA with the PT4400. And they recomend the SS4000 for spray. Even though it is only 400rpm difference, it is much tighter.
